Miami, FL. — Authorities in Miami-Dade County are investigating a string of gruesome homicides that officials believe may be the work of a new serial killer whose disturbing method of operation involves using a chainsaw to mutilate victims.
Miami-Dade Sheriff's confirmed late Friday that at least three victims have been discovered in the past two weeks, each found in rentals across the Miami-Dade County. Investigators say the bodies were “severely dismembered,” with early forensic evidence indicating the use of a chainsaw.
“This is unlike anything we’ve seen in recent years,” said Sergeant Parzival Queen of the Miami-Dade Sheriff’s Office. “The level of violence, the precision, and the repetition of the crime scene signatures lead us to believe we are dealing with a highly dangerous individual who may kill again.”
The most recent victim, identified as a 34-year-old male, was discovered behind an abandoned warehouse in Hialeah on Wednesday night. Neighbors reported hearing the sound of machinery in the early morning hours, but assumed it came from nearby construction.
Police have yet to release the names of all victims, but investigators revealed that they appear to have no immediate connection to one another, suggesting the attacks may be random.
Miami-Dade residents are urged to remain vigilant, avoid isolated areas late at night, and report any suspicious activity immediately.
“We are throwing every available resource at this case,” Sergeant Parzival added. “The public should know we will not rest until this individual is apprehended.”
